Manalapan, FL, December 31, 2009 — We know in our hearts when we receive ‘nudges’ from God to do something good – we just don’t always respond to those subtle nudges. The Tap (Health Communications, Inc.), by best-selling author Frank McKinney, is all about accepting this responsibility and achieving the confidence to handle the “more” we all pray for – wealth, health, happiness, love, peace, relationships, etc.

Frank McKinney is a man who truly does ‘walk the talk.’ He has achieved great success, and he attributes this to the fact that he has responded to his own ‘tap’ moments in life by donating generously to his non-profit Caring House Project Foundation (CHPF) that provides a self-sustaining existence for desperately poor and homeless families around the world.

The inspiration for McKinney’s stirring book came from the biblical passage from Luke 12:48 “from those to whom much is entrusted, much will be expected,” believing that God repeatedly ‘taps’ each one of us many times in life, answering prayers and presenting life-changing opportunities, and what determines our success is how we respond to these ‘taps.’ By applying this refreshing idea of entrusted time, talent and treasure, he shares with the world how God’s great ‘tap’ moments show that compassionate capitalism and spiritual stewardship can co-exist.
